Copenhagen summer hallelujah
Spending a summer in Copenhagen truly feels like a hallelujah moment. One of the standout features is how the city comes alive under the long hours of sunlight—the sun remains visible until as late as 11pm during peak summer, creating unforgettable sunsets that painters and photographers dream of. Cycling is deeply ingrained in the local culture, and experiencing Copenhagen means hopping on a bike to explore its vibrant neighborhoods and waterfront areas. It's a wonderfully healthy and scenic way to get around, offering frequent encounters with friendly locals and quaint street corners. Food is another delightful part of the Copenhagen summer experience. Simple pleasures such as enjoying a bun with cheese—sometimes paired with a glass of refreshing orange wine—are common highlights that perfectly complement a day of exploration. Moreover, taking morning dips in nearby water spots like La Banchina is invigorating and refreshing; locals swear by it as an energizing start to their day. The combination of sun exposure and active outdoor lifestyle helps many to dodge seasonal depression, making summers in this city particularly heartwarming and uplifting. All of these moments—whether it’s biking everywhere, tasting local treats, or soaking in the endless sunshine—paint a picture of joyful summer living that invites visitors and residents alike to celebrate life in Copenhagen.
